Comprehending UPVC Doors
Before delving into renovation methods, it is vital to comprehend what makes UPVC doors a favored option for homes and organizations alike. UPVC doors are designed to stand up to the elements, resist wetness, and supply exceptional insulation. They typically require less maintenance compared to wooden or fiberglass doors, making them a convenient choice.

Step 1: Initial Assessment
Begin with an extensive examination of the door, trying to find indications of wear, damage, or inefficiency. Take down:
Area of ConcernDescriptionSurface area WearFading, scratches, or damagesSeals and WeatherstrippingHarmed or missing weather condition sealsHardwareRusted locks, hinges, or deals withEnergy EfficiencyGaps or drafts affecting insulationAction 2: Cleaning
Clean the UPVC door using a mild soap service and a soft cloth. Prevent abrasive products that can scratch the surface. Pay unique attention to locations around the seals and hardware.
Step 3: Repairing or Replacing Hardware
Inspect all hardware elements, including locks, manages, and hinges. If any parts are rusty or broken, replace them with brand-new ones. Here's a basic list of hardware alternatives to consider:
Multi-point locking system: Enhances security.Stainless-steel handles: Resists corrosion and improves aesthetics.Hinges: Heavy-duty hinges for sturdiness.Step 4: Painting or Refinishing
If the door has faded or scratched, painting or refinishing is an option. UPVC-specific paints are readily available in a range of colors. Here's how to do it:
Sand the Surface: Lightly sand the door to promote adhesion.Tidy: Wipe the door to eliminate dust.Prime: Apply a primer suited for UPVC.Paint: Use a roller or spray paint for an even coat.Seal: Once dry, use a sealant to protect the surface.Step 5: Seal Replacement
Analyze the seals around the Door Panel Maintenance. If they appear cracked or worn, think about changing them. This action is important for preserving energy efficiency and need to be carried out as follows:
Remove old seals.Tidy the surface completely.Procedure and cut the new seal to size.Apply the new seal securely, making sure a tight fit.Action 6: Final Evaluation
After finishing the renovations, re-evaluate the door to guarantee all repair work and updates are adequate. Examine the performance of locks, seals, and the visual look of the paint or surface.
